What Makes A Ribeye Steak Tough?

The hardest cuts are those that have a lot of connective tissue and come from a muscle that has been regularly exercised. The quantity of connective tissue in the muscles rises as a result of exercise, making the muscles stronger. The most sensitive wounds are those that have very little connective tissue and come from a muscle that hasn’t been utilized in a long time.

What are the different grades of ribeye steak?

Because of the marbling process, the three primary categories of prime, choice, and select are decided. Prime is the greatest possible rating, while select is the lowest possible grade. Please keep in mind that, despite the low grade of selection, this is the leanest cut of ribeye steak that can be purchased. Unfortunately, it also has the least amount of taste.

Why are my ribeye steaks tough?

Undercooked steaks are tough and chewy because the fat in the beef has not been melted. Aside from that, undercooked meat might induce an upset stomach or even food illness. Overcooked steaks lose all of their fat and become hard, dry, and chewy as a result of the cooking process.

What causes steak to be rough and chewy at times? In addition, steak becomes rough and chewy when the meat is not of high quality and freshness, when the cut is not appropriate for the cooking technique, when the steak is too skinny, and when the steak has been under or overdone. Additionally, if the steaks are not rested after cooking and are not cut against the grain, they will be tough.

Why is my steak always tough?

The most typical cause for a steak to become chewy is that it was cooked for an excessive amount of time. Steaks should be cooked for a short period of time at a high temperature. This allows the fat to melt and be equally distributed throughout the flesh, resulting in a juicy and tender piece of meat.

Should I marinate ribeye steak?

Because of the considerable fat marbling in rib eye steaks, they are very flavorful cuts of meat to cook with. Technically, they don’t require a marinade to be delicious because they are bursting with flavor on their own.
